Bamberg, South Carolina (June 2020) – On June 10, Bamberg County announced that a Bamberg County employee tested positive for COVID-19. The employee worked in the Bamberg County Courthouse Annex and has not had close contact with other county employees for at least a week. All county employees were informed of the positive case. Bamberg County Voter Registration and Elections Office announce that their office will be open on Satuday, June 6, 2020, the last Saturday prior to Primaries. The office hours will be from 9:00 a.m. to 1:00 p.m. The office is located at the Bamberg County Courthouse Annex, 1234 North St., Bamberg, SC. Their phone number is 803-245-3028.
